Possible disadvantages of GitStreak

  • May encourage low-quality commits
    The pressure to maintain a streak can lead developers to make trivial or meaningless commits just to keep the streak alive, rather than focusing on meaningful, high-quality contributions.
  • Limited scope
    GitStreak focuses only on GitHub contributions, so it doesn't account for work done on other platforms like GitLab, Bitbucket, or local repositories that aren't pushed to GitHub.
  • Potential for burnout
    The pressure of maintaining a daily streak can lead to developer burnout, as users may feel obligated to code every single day without taking necessary breaks for rest and recovery.
  • Misleading productivity metric
    Streak length is not a reliable indicator of developer productivity or skill. It can create a false sense of accomplishment or pressure based on a vanity metric rather than actual code quality or project impact.
  • Dependency on GitHub's contribution tracking
    GitStreak relies on GitHub's contribution graph and tracking mechanisms, which can sometimes miss contributions or have specific rules about what counts as a contribution, leading to potential inaccuracies.

What's the story behind your product?

GitStreak's answer

Ever have that gut-punch moment when you lose a streak?

Yeah, me too.

GitStreak was born from a moment of frustration when I lost my GitHub contribution streak.

Not because I didnโ€™t code, but because I simply forgot to sync.

It was the weekend and without my trusty Deskhub displaying my contribution graph on my office desk, it completely slipped my mind.

While I wouldnโ€™t say I was heartbroken (thatโ€™s a bit dramatic), it was definitely a facepalm moment.

As someone who thrives on daily challenges and building new habits, Iโ€™ve learned that sometimes we all need a friendly nudge.

Thatโ€™s exactly what I love about Duolingo โ€” it keeps me accountable with timely reminders.

So I thought, โ€œWhy not create the same for fellow developers?โ€

GitStreak is exactly that: a simple email reminder service that helps you maintain your GitHub streak.

No bells, no whistles โ€” just a friendly ping when you need it.

And the best part?

If youโ€™ve already committed that day, weโ€™ll stay quiet and let you bask in your productivity, keeping your inbox clutter-free.
